📌 Munich Security Report warns of Trump as a “demolition man” of the world order
The Munich Security Report 2026 warns the world is entering “wrecking-ball politics” led by U.S. President Donald Trump, placing severe strain on the post-1945 international order. It argues his approach could replace principled cooperation with transactional deals, weakening long-standing alliances and norms, amid broad public pessimism on living standards and inequality.

📌 King Charles says Buckingham Palace will support police on Andrew–Epstein claims
King Charles intervened publicly amid new Epstein-file revelations, stating Buckingham Palace will support police if asked as they assess allegations involving Prince Andrew. Thames Valley Police confirmed it is reviewing a complaint alleging misconduct in public office and breaches of official secrets; reports cite newly released emails suggesting Andrew shared confidential travel reports and investment information with Epstein. Andrew denies wrongdoing.

📌 Investigation alleges Ethiopia hosts covert camp training Sudan’s RSF fighters
A visual investigation says Ethiopia is hosting a secret camp in Benishangul-Gumuz to train thousands of fighters for Sudan’s RSF, highlighting regional spillover from Sudan’s civil war. Sources allege UAE financing and support, which Reuters could not independently verify and the UAE denies. Satellite imagery reportedly shows expansion, heavy vehicle movement, and nearby infrastructure consistent with drone support.
